My Buying Guides on Best Biography Of Napoleon Bonaparte

Why I Look for the Right Napoleon Biography

When I shop for a biography of Napoleon Bonaparte, I want more than just dates and battles. I look for a book that helps me understand his personality, leadership, ambition, mistakes, and lasting influence on Europe and the world. A good biography should feel engaging, accurate, and balanced, so I can enjoy the story while also learning real history.

What I Check Before Buying

Before I choose a Napoleon biography, I usually pay attention to a few important things:

  • Author credibility: I prefer writers who are respected historians or biographers with strong research backgrounds.
  • Depth of coverage: I check whether the book covers his early life, rise to power, military campaigns, exile, and legacy.
  • Writing style: I like books that are clear and readable, not overly academic unless I want a scholarly study.
  • Balance: I want a biography that shows both Napoleon’s brilliance and his flaws.
  • Length: I consider whether I want a short introduction or a detailed, full-length biography.
  • Reviews: I always look at reader reviews to see if the book is engaging and well organized.

Different Types of Napoleon Biographies I Consider

I have found that Napoleon biographies usually fall into a few categories, and each one serves a different purpose:

  • Short biographies: These are best when I want a quick overview of his life and achievements.
  • Comprehensive biographies: I choose these when I want a deep, detailed understanding of Napoleon’s entire life.
  • Military-focused biographies: These are useful when I want to study his strategies, campaigns, and battlefield decisions.
  • Psychological or political biographies: I read these when I want insight into his character, leadership style, and ambitions.
